Taxonomic Classification
| Rank | Barrow's Goldeneye | Mexican Ground Squirrel |
|---|---|---|
| Kingdom same | Animalia (Animals) | Animalia (Animals) |
| Phylum same | Chordata (Chordates) | Chordata (Chordates) |
| Class | Aves (Birds) | Mammalia (Mammals) |
| Order | Anseriformes (Anseriformes) | Rodentia (Rodents) |
| Family | Anatidae | Sciuridae (Squirrels) |
| Genus | Bucephala | Ictidomys |
| Species | Bucephala islandica | Ictidomys mexicanus |
Evolutionary Relationship
Barrow's Goldeneye and Mexican Ground Squirrel share a common ancestor at the Phylum level: Chordata. (Chordates)
